> I was interested in knowing about the JRE Licensing/Resitrictions for > JRE for FreeBSD. I have come across the following for JRE for Windows > and was wondering if the same restrictions apply for JRE for FreeBSD > (both v1.1.6 and v1.1.7): We're using the same source that is used under Windows, so whatever licensing restrictions exist in the stuff distributed by Sun exist in the FreeBSD version as well.
